Great American comfort food! Smile Jun 03, 2015   
Share on TwitterShare on Facebook
Categories : Western variety | Restaurant | Burgers / Sandwiches

My group of friends and I chanced upon Johnny Rockets and I haven't had it since I left the US, so I decided to give it a try.

1. Chicken Melt Sandwich 15ringgit

 
Okay, I was a bit surprised to learn that it wasn't a sandwich flooded with cheese and pressed on a sandwich press. In fact, it took me awhile to find the small slice of swiss cheese in my sandwich. On the bright side, there was one large onion ring, a load of barbecue sauce sauce and a tender piece of chicken. The whole sandwich itself was too much for me to eat. So I ate half and my friend took care of the other half. These are the typical large portions you would find at any American dinner!

2. Oreo Milkshake 13.90ringgit

 
It was more of a ice cream waiting to be melted into a milkshake, the second metal cup was about 1/4 full with the remaining portion of the milkshake. It wasn't the best milkshake I had, but it was okay. I would still think steak and shake 2-3USD milkshakes would beat this hands down!

 
This was my friend's burger, who told me it was very very good!

 
The dining area, there was ample space for big groups of customers

 
Here is the menu.

The staff were very friendly and polite, happily greeting everyone that walked past the shop, customer or not.

Best tasting beef noodles!! Smile May 18, 2015   
Share on TwitterShare on Facebook
Categories : Malaysian variety | Restaurant | Halal

 
Located pretty close to the high way exit is this infamous beef noodles, that I travelled all the way from Singapore to try! It was a saturday morning around 930am and it seemed pretty quiet, not many customers, and though there are quite a number of newspaper clippings, this coffee shop seemed like a normal looking coffee shop. Nothing too fanciful that made it stand out from the neighbouring shops. It has a very old school feel to it, probably because this shop has been here for decades!

 
Straight away, when you walk into the coffee shop, you can smell the sweet scent of beef and the broth. That's because there is a giant pot boiling right at the entrance. You can see the chunks of meat, herbs and even bones. A very welcoming sight indeed!

 
I love kway teow so I ordered my bowl with kway teow, you can choose between bee hoon, yellow mee, mee pok, and kway teow. The first thing you will notice is that they are fried onions on the bowl, which were very crispy. The second thing you will notice are the numerous chunks of beef and innards. I was quite surprised that there was so much "liao" aka ingredients. We definitely don't get so much "liao" in a bowl of beef noodles in Singapore. The shop here is very generous!
Kway teow

Kway teow

 
The soup was so tasty! And yet I didn't feel thirsty after the meal, the soup is refillable, and I couldn't resist ordering a second bowl. I'm so greedy, but it was definitely the best bowl of beef noodles I have ever eaten!!

 
After the meal, I walked to the back of the shop to use the wash basin and noticed the staff fishing out huge bones from the boiling broth. Wow! Now I know why the soup is so tasty! It's legit bones, herbs and meat that spends hours broiling to give you that unforgettable beef noodle soup!
Supplementary Information:
If you cannot eat beef for religious reasons, you can still ask for a small bowl of noodles and soup without any meat.

Drink a Selfie Coffee!! Smile May 18, 2015   
Share on TwitterShare on Facebook
Categories : Western variety | Café | Sweets/Snack

 
So everyone is familiar with using your front facing camera to take a selfie! But what about a selfie coffee? Originating from Penang, Selfie Coffee is the first coffee in Malaysia that allows you to snap photos of yourself and get it printed onto the foam of a drink!

 
This signboard outside the shop says it all! You might find it strange at first, but it's quite a lot of fun!

 
The interior of the shop is pretty simplistic, with fake grass plastered on the walls which has lots of power points. I guess the shop doesn't mind if you use their power points to charge an iphone. They also have free wifi! We had trouble connecting to it and it was rather slow. But it was a full house on a friday night at 11pm. Yes they open till midnight on friday!

 
Here is their cake display, what stood out to me was the mascarpone green tea cake. I only use mascarpone for Tiramisu cakes so I had to try that and of course the infamous rainbow cake. I cannot resist a rainbow cake when I see one!

1. Rainbow Cake 10.90RM+

 
The colours of this rainbow cake is so bright and pretty. The cake tasted moist and the butter cream was very lightly layered in between the sponges, so it did not taste sweet. However the top and side layers of the chocolate rice was abit hard and for kids, they will love it. But to me, it didn't add any benefits to the rainbow cake. Maybe they should've just stuck with the normal butter cream around the cake? Nonetheless, still a great tasting and good looking rainbow cake!

2. Green Tea Mascarpone cake 9.90RM+

 
I loved the red bean layers in this cake, you can also distinctively taste the green tea and also the mascarpone. I am in love with this cake and I'm definitely getting a slice of this everytime I go there!

 
I also liked that they decorated the plates with chocolate sauce smile At the same time, they also use it to write the table number so that the food gets delivered to the right tables.

3. Original Belgian Waffle 4.90RM+

 
It strangely tasted very salty and though I've tasted salty waffles, that's usually because the waffle is served with ice cream or something that helps offset the saltiness. However, since this was a plain waffle with chocolate sauce drizzle and some whipped cream topping, the waffle just tasted overly salty. The corners of the waffle were crispy but the rest of the waffle was so "cake-like", I wouldn't call it fluffy. I could almost close my eyes and think that I was eating a dense butter sponge cake. This is definitely my first time tasting such a waffle. Maybe they should consider having an ice cream topping for their waffles instead.

The waffle options they had were :
1. Original
2. Chocolate
3. Banana
4. Strawberry
5. Mango
6. Honeydew
7. Green tea 

4. Hot Salted Caramel 13.00RM+

 
Even though we ordered it hot, it came pretty cold. Like room temperature, it wasn't even a little bit warm. So we asked for another cup and the owner apologised and politely feedbacked to the kitchen staff. Our second cup was warmer, but still nowhere as warm as the word "warm" means to anyone. I would still deem it as cold. It tasted ok, I couldn't taste the salt. Reminds me of a Skinny Caramel Macchiato from Starbucks.

5. Selfie Coffee 13.00RM+

 
We waited about 20 minutes, during which we ate our cakes, waffle and salted caramel drink, before we were ushered into the photo booth. You can take a few photos and choose your favourite photo. Then after which, you wait another 5-10 minutes for your drink. I must say, the printer foam dpi is pretty damn good, cause it's pretty sharp!

 
So it looks good! Does it taste good? Yes! It tastes exactly how an iced matcha latte should taste like!! I enjoyed my drink, if only their hot drinks were somewhat close to being hot, I would definitely vote this as the best cafe in JB!50RM for 2 cakes, 2 drinks and a waffle, pretty pricey I think for a JB cafe, but reasonable for the the fact that it would cost twice as much in Singapore!

Service was very good throughout the whole time there, when we needed more white board markers because our marker ran out of ink, there were staff to help us grab more markers. The tables are glass and so they're pretty much a white board, which you can doodle on. A great idea, considering there would be a bottleneck of customers waiting to go into the photo booth.

The owner himself, a young chap was open to feedback and was very polite and friendly. I do hope they continue to expand their menu and possibly do a selfie rainbow cake! That would be awesome!

Supplementary Information:
Free wifi, free electricity for laptops/phone charges and there is a 6% GST charge on all items.

Categories : Indian | Restaurant | Noodles | Nasi Lemak

 

Located just across the Petronas Towers is this mamak that is opened 24 hours. We visited on a Sunday at 1030am and there were a lot of customers, including a street bike gang!
Parkin is readily available along the streets, adjacent to the mamak.

 

I got a mango lassi 6RM to cool myself down on a super hot day! It was slightly sour but I was okay with that! I would rather have a slightly sour one than one that was overdosed with sugar syrup! At least I know that this was authentic mango! 

 

The Prata here is awesome! Super cridpy and the kaya was thinly spread in the roti prata. It was quite sweet and my sensitive teeth wasn't too happy with it! The dhal curry wasn't that fantastic.

 

Kway Teow goreng is damn Shiok! A lot of wok Hei! This was supposedly the drier version, which they will ask you which kind you want. Even though this is the drier version, it was still drenched in oil. I did enjoy this calorie laden dish! Definitely getting this again the next time I visit KL!

 

The nasi Ayam goreng was also great, the rice was slightly charred too! For 22.80RM for 2 pax, it was reasonably priced to me! smile and you can also enjoy a great view of the KL iconic landmark at the same time!

Great brunch place! Smile Mar 28, 2015   
Share on TwitterShare on Facebook
Categories : Western variety | Café | Sweets/Snack

 

Facing the main road, near Neo damanura is the metal box!

 

The interior is quite spacious, and it wasn't crowded on a Saturday at 1130am. There are glass bottles of water on the table for yourself to help yourself to the water.

 

Here is their menu. They have a decent variety of food to choose from.

 

There are also c ales at the cashier, all looked so good! And they were said to be made from scratch, in house!

 

I got the speciality French toast and for 15.90rm I felt that it was reasonably priced. It was very filling as it was made of nest in. I could only eat two slices. The gula Melaka was an interesting addition To the French toast.

 

Usually most hipster cafes will serve this with honey but not the metal box! 

 

Here is our breakfast spread.

 

The flat white was decent but nothing to rave about. They also have free wifi.. The password is the metalrocket.
